Woman claims children kidnapped then found near 7th AvenueParkersburg WV

audio iconMedical Emergency
7th Ave, Parkersburg, WV 26101

A woman called 911 stating her children were kidnapped and taken near 7th Avenue but repeatedly hung up, believing callers were impostors. Police found her at a nearby gas station, where she appeared emotionally unstable.
